KILKENNY -- I know of only two Irish PR professionals who blog and it's fair to say that most in the Irish PR arena do not know about Weblogs. Why would someone in the PR community want to blog?
Angelo Fernando remembers that as a contributing editor to a business magazine in Sri Lanka, "I once created a Web site to post story kernels and backgrounders. A Blog now lets me do this more efficiently, and to fire off a hyperlink or two to someone who wants more references on a topic. It also allows valuable feedback, sometimes providing new angles for new topics.
"But I maintain a blog not to be a placeholder or for feedback. Blogs are well suited to adjust to the changing angles, facts and nuances of a story."
Fernando thinks blogging is important to PR because bloggers abhor hype. "I think it is important because it brings communication back to its roots; a
return to what’s authentic and personal."
